Fighting Together: Liz and Mike’s Story of Love, Resilience, and Kidney Advocacy

Mike Chicalas is no stranger to kidney disease. His mother, uncle, and grandmother all battled it. Around age 24, Mike began experiencing kidney problems and started dialysis. He received his first transplant in 2007, thanks to a kidney donated by his sister.
